#!/usr/bin/env php
<?php
$composerAutoload = [
__DIR__ . '/vendor/autoload.php', // standalone with "composer install" run
__DIR__ . '/../../autoload.php', // script is installed as a composer binary
];
foreach ($composerAutoload as $autoload) {
if (file_exists($autoload)) {
require($autoload);
break;
}
}
// Send all errors to stderr
ini_set('display_errors', 'stderr');
$full = false;
$src = [];
foreach($argv as $k => $arg) {
if ($k == 0) {
continue;
}
if ($arg[0] == '-') {
$arg = explode('=', $arg);
switch($arg[0]) {
case '--full':
$full = true;
break;
case '-h':
case '--help':
echo "PHP Markdown to HTML converter\n";
usage();
break;
default:
error("Unknown argument " . $arg[0], "usage");
}
} else {
$src[] = $arg;
}
}
if (empty($src)) {
$markdown = file_get_contents("php://stdin");
} elseif (count($src) == 1) {
$file = reset($src);
if (!file_exists($file)) {
error("File does not exist:" . $file);
}
$markdown = file_get_contents($file);
} else {
error("Converting multiple files is not yet supported.", "usage");
}
$Parsedown = new Parsedown();
$markup = $Parsedown->text($markdown);
if ($full) {
echo <<<HTML
<!DOCTYPE HTML PUBLIC "-//W3C//DTD HTML 4.01 Transitional//EN"
"http://www.w3.org/TR/html4/loose.dtd">
<html>
<head>
<meta http-equiv="content-type" content="text/html; charset=utf-8">
<style>
body { font-family: Arial, sans-serif; }
code { background: #eeeeff; padding: 2px; }
li { margin-bottom: 5px; }
img { max-width: 1200px; }
table, td, th { border: solid 1px #ccc; border-collapse: collapse; }
</style>
</head>
<body>
$markup
</body>
</html>
HTML;
} else {
echo $markup;
}
// functions
/**
* Display usage information
*/
function usage() {
global $argv;
$cmd = $argv[0];
echo <<<EOF
Usage:
$cmd [--flavor=<flavor>] [--full] [file.md]
--flavor specifies the markdown flavor to use. If omitted the original markdown by John Gruber [1] will be used.
Available flavors:
gfm - Github flavored markdown [2]
extra - Markdown Extra [3]
--full ouput a full HTML page with head and body. If not given, only the parsed markdown will be output.
--help shows this usage information.
If no file is specified input will be read from STDIN.
Examples:
Render a file with original markdown:
$cmd README.md > README.html
Render a file using gihtub flavored markdown:
$cmd --flavor=gfm README.md > README.html
Convert the original markdown description to html using STDIN:
curl http://daringfireball.net/projects/markdown/syntax.text | $cmd > md.html
[1] http://daringfireball.net/projects/markdown/syntax
EOF;
exit(1);
}
/**
* Send custom error message to stderr
* @param $message string
* @param $callback mixed called before script exit
* @return void
*/
function error($message, $callback = null) {
$fe = fopen("php://stderr", "w");
fwrite($fe, "Error: " . $message . "\n");
if (is_callable($callback)) {
call_user_func($callback);
}
exit(1);
}
